Business and Economic News: August 2025

Global Economic Overview

The global economy continues to face mixed signals. Inflation remains a concern in several countries. Central banks are still weighing the need for further interest rate hikes. The U.S. economy, however, shows signs of resilience. Job growth is steady, and consumer spending remains strong.

Corporate Earnings Season

The latest earnings season has provided a glimpse into the health of major corporations. Many companies have reported solid profits, exceeding analysts’ expectations. Tech companies, in particular, have seen strong growth. However, some sectors, like retail, are facing challenges due to changing consumer behavior.

Technology and Innovation

Innovation continues to drive the technology sector. Artificial intelligence (AI) is transforming various industries. Companies are investing heavily in AI research and development. This investment is expected to boost productivity and create new business opportunities. Meanwhile, concerns about AI ethics and regulation remain.

Energy Markets

Energy prices remain volatile. Geopolitical tensions and supply disruptions are contributing factors. The U.S. is increasing its domestic energy production to reduce reliance on foreign sources. Renewable energy sources are also gaining traction, with solar and wind power becoming more competitive.

International Trade

Trade relations between the U.S. and other countries are evolving. New trade agreements are being negotiated. Tariffs and trade disputes continue to impact global supply chains. Businesses are adapting to these changes by diversifying their supply sources and exploring new markets.

Financial Markets Update

U.S. stock markets have experienced some volatility. Investors are reacting to economic data and corporate news. Interest rates and inflation are key factors influencing market sentiment. Financial advisors recommend a diversified investment strategy to manage risk.

Real Estate Trends

The U.S. housing market is showing signs of stabilization. Mortgage rates are still relatively high. This impacts home affordability. Demand remains strong in certain regions, but inventory levels are increasing in some areas.

Consumer Spending

Consumer spending is a major driver of the U.S. economy. Retail sales data shows a mixed picture. Consumers are still spending, but they are becoming more selective. Inflation is impacting purchasing power, and many households are looking for ways to save money.

Future Outlook

The economic outlook for the rest of 2025 is uncertain. Several factors could impact growth, including inflation, interest rates, and geopolitical events. Businesses and consumers should remain prepared for potential challenges and opportunities.
